In the vast landscape of digital illustration, certain names become synonymous with highly specific niches. One such name that has generated substantial search volume and curiosity over the last two decades is "John Persons." Associated with a distinct, hyper-stylized form of adult artwork, the phrase refers to a massive library of underground, explicitly themed digital illustrations that gained cult status during the early-to-mid 2000s internet boom. Unlike traditional print cartoonists, John Persons operated almost exclusively in the digital realm. The comics were primary distributed through premium, membership-based websites. The most famous of these hubs was affectionately or notoriously known within the community as "Big Blue"—a reference to the distinct blue background design of the central distribution website. Users paid monthly subscriptions to access galleries of high-resolution comic pages, which were updated incrementally. Artistic Style and Technical Execution
